If you cannot find the specific PDF or prefer a more updated text, consider these authoritative books on Indian Cyber Law:
| Book Title | Author | Publisher | USP | | :--- | :--- | :--- | :--- | | Law of Cyber Crimes & IT Act | Karnika Seth | LexisNexis | Focus on Criminal jurisprudence | | Cyber Laws | Talat Fatima | Eastern Book Company | Excellent for case law analysis | | Commentary on IT Act | P.M. Bakshi | LexisNexis | The classic, though slightly dated | | Guide to Cyber Laws | Rodney D. Ryder | Wadhwa Nagpur | Practical guide for corporate lawyers |

In the labyrinth of Indian jurisprudence, few areas have evolved as rapidly—and as turbulently—as Cyber Law. From the dial-up era of the Information Technology Act, 2000 (IT Act), to the contemporary conundrums of cryptocurrency bans, deepfake liability, and cross-border data breaches, the legal framework has often played a frantic game of catch-up with technology.
For law students, IT professionals, and enforcement officers, navigating this terrain requires more than a collection of bare acts. It requires a guide—one that contextualizes Section 66A’s infamous demise and interprets the subtle shifts of the Digital Personal Data Protection Act (DPDPA), 2023.
That guide, for over a decade, has been "Cyber Law in India" by Farooq Ahmad, published by Pioneer Books. But is this textbook merely a syllabus filler, or does it serve as a genuine roadmap for understanding digital rights in the subcontinent? Let’s break down its DNA.
| Feature Category | Details | | :--- | :--- | | Core Legislation | IT Act, 2000 & IT (Amendment) Act, 2008. | | Crimes Covered | Hacking, Cyber Stalking, Phishing, Identity Theft, Cyber Terrorism. | | Civil Issues | Data Protection, Privacy, Intellectual Property, E-Contracts. | | Unique Selling Point | Simplified explanation of technical legal concepts for Indian judiciary context. |

For legal professionals and students in India, "Cyber Law in India" by Farooq Ahmad, published by Pioneer Books, is considered a foundational text that bridges the gap between traditional law and the complexities of the digital age. First released around 2001, shortly after the enactment of the Information Technology Act, 2000, the book provides an exhaustive analysis of the internet's legal landscape.
